52-year-old Cai Yujun from Sichuan has been taking care of his 92-year-old mother who is suffering from dementia. Her condition has been getting worse and it’s no longer safe to leave her alone. Her condition requires constant vigilance which is tough because Yujun and his wife both have hectic work schedules.
Yujun and his wife work long hours in order to provide for their family and household.

He decided that the best course of action would be to bring his mother along to his job. Yujun works as a transporter and that requires him to constantly be on the move.
He decided to make some modifications to his motorcycle to accommodate his mother and widened the back seat with wooden planks. On top of that, he also added wooden pedals so his mother can rest her feet.
He even made seat belts out of hemp and secured his mother firmly to himself to ensure she would not fall off.

He takes his mother wherever he goes. Yujun says he does not deliver goods all day and when it is a relatively slow day, he would entertain his mother by the roadside. She has made friends along the way and Yujun said it’s a good thing that she’s out getting fresh air instead of being cooped up at home.
Yujun has been caring for his mother for years but has never found it a hassle.

He stated emotionally, “Mom dedicated her life to the family so it’s only natural to be responsible and take care of her for as long as she’s around, no matter how tough it gets.”
